Step 1: Define Your Channel's Purpose

Before diving into the technical aspects of creating a second YouTube channel, it's crucial to define the purpose of your channel. Ask yourself:

  • What is the main focus of this new channel?
  • Who is the target audience?
  • How is it different from your existing channel?

Having a clear understanding of your channel's purpose will guide your content creation and help you attract the right audience.

Step 2: Sign in with a Different Google Account

In order to create a second YouTube channel, you'll need a separate Google account. If you don't already have one, create a new Google account using a different email address from your existing channel's account.

To sign in with your new Google account:

  1. Go to the YouTube homepage and click on the profile icon in the top-right corner.
  2. Select "Switch account" from the drop-down menu.
  3. Then, click on "Add account".
  4. Follow the prompts to sign in with your new Google account.

Step 3: Create a Brand Account

Once signed in with your new Google account, it's time to create a brand account for your second YouTube channel. A brand account allows multiple users to manage and contribute to the channel, which is ideal if you plan to collaborate with others or hire a team.

To create a brand account:

  1. Click on the profile icon again and select "Settings".
  2. In the left sidebar, choose "Your channel".
  3. Click on the "Use a business or other name" link.
  4. Enter the name of your channel and click "Create".

Step 4: Customize Your Channel

Now that you have created your brand account, it's time to personalize your second YouTube channel. Upload a unique channel icon, add an eye-catching channel art, and write a compelling channel description that accurately represents your content.

To customize your channel:

  1. Click on the profile icon and select your new channel.
  2. Click on "Customize channel" on the right.
  3. Select the "Customize Layout" option and make changes as desired.
  4. Don't forget to click "Publish" to save your changes.

Step 5: Start Uploading Content

Your second YouTube channel is now ready for content! Start by brainstorming ideas and planning your videos to ensure consistent uploads.

When uploading videos, be sure to:

  • Use relevant keywords in your video titles, descriptions, and tags for better discoverability.
  • Create eye-catching thumbnails to increase click-through rates.
  • Promote your new channel on your existing channel to leverage your current audience.

Remember, consistency and quality are key to building a successful YouTube channel.
